aboutsumma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2022-09-05Transpose on 1 axis is a no-opMarshall Lochbaum
2022-09-05Support Latin-1 alphabetic characters (leaving undocumented/unspecified for now)Marshall Lochbaum
2022-09-05BREAKING: enclose atom argument in ⟨⟩↕atom to align with other 0-axis ↵Marshall Lochbaum
primitives
2022-09-04Avoid fuzzing error when dyadic ¬ is implemented as 1+-Marshall Lochbaum
2022-09-04Turn enclosed atoms into atoms half the time for dyadic arithmeticMarshall Lochbaum
2022-09-03Swapped + for -Marshall Lochbaum
2022-09-02Error messages changedMarshall Lochbaum
2022-09-02Notes on linear searches (including vector binary) and vector 256-bit tablesMarshall Lochbaum
2022-09-01Notes on sparse lookups, with revisions to reverse lookups and partitioningMarshall Lochbaum
2022-09-01TypoMarshall Lochbaum
2022-08-31Fix grammar for arg not allowing assignment within expressionsMarshall Lochbaum
2022-08-30Use 0< instead of × everywhere in the compilerMarshall Lochbaum
2022-08-30Don't allow Conjugate (monadic +) on non-number atomsMarshall Lochbaum
2022-08-28Some notes on hash tablesMarshall Lochbaum
2022-08-23Notes on lookup tablesMarshall Lochbaum
2022-08-22Update partitioned hashing notesMarshall Lochbaum
2022-08-21Point out that defining √⁼ to be ט gives it an extended domainMarshall Lochbaum
2022-08-21Fix J translation of monadic ⍒ (closes #78)Marshall Lochbaum
2022-08-21Notes on reverse and partitioned search implementationMarshall Lochbaum
2022-08-20Update comments on CBQN performance: most things implemented nativelyMarshall Lochbaum
2022-08-20Fix double-header check when there's strandingMarshall Lochbaum
2022-08-19Fix reused nameMarshall Lochbaum
2022-08-17Index-based is better than mask-based tracing (e.g. for strings and comments)Marshall Lochbaum
2022-08-17TypoMarshall Lochbaum
2022-08-16Document what programs and errors areMarshall Lochbaum
2022-08-16Better documentation for SpanMarshall Lochbaum
2022-08-15Rework page on logic functionsMarshall Lochbaum
2022-08-14Add fuzz test for ´˝` on lists, with -m option to pick operandsMarshall Lochbaum
2022-08-14Merge pull request #77 from SteveUlin/patch-2Marshall Lochbaum
[fifty.bqn] Update to fifty.bqn to use scans
2022-08-14[fifty.bqn] Update to fifty.bqn to use scansSteveU
Update #9 and #10 to use scans rather than nested arrays. Scans are faster, and I feel like provide a better working example for new BQN programmers. However, this does change the math a bit as scans in BQN are left to right whereas APL's are right to left.
2022-08-12Fix broken sentenceMarshall Lochbaum
2022-08-12CorrectionsMarshall Lochbaum
2022-08-11Add discussion of primitive overloadingMarshall Lochbaum
2022-08-11Join error message changed in CBQNMarshall Lochbaum
2022-08-06Add ktye's array language zoo to running.mdMarshall Lochbaum
2022-08-06Mention prism.js support in editors READMEMarshall Lochbaum
2022-08-02Rework prose and rebuild birds.mdMarshall Lochbaum
2022-08-02Test for lazy logic if Join shape checking is done in one passMarshall Lochbaum
2022-08-02Merge pull request #75 from codereport/birdsMarshall Lochbaum
:memo: Update to Combinator Birds
2022-08-02Update to phi(1)Conor Hoekstra
2022-07-31Remove discussion left over from older example code (closes #74)Marshall Lochbaum
2022-07-29Link to combinatorylogic.com on birds pageMarshall Lochbaum
2022-07-29K tree is pretty quiet nowMarshall Lochbaum
2022-07-24Editing pass over first two tutorialsMarshall Lochbaum
2022-07-24Recompile JS bytecodeMarshall Lochbaum
2022-07-24Check for export statements used in parens or list/array notationMarshall Lochbaum
2022-07-24Check for block punctuation inside parensMarshall Lochbaum
2022-07-22Mention that it's harder for compilers to support new architecturesMarshall Lochbaum
2022-07-22Can't find a reliable attribution of the L1 cache claim to WhitneyMarshall Lochbaum
2022-07-21Link to published K benchmarks specificallyMarshall Lochbaum